Adam Turner 1762–1835 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 6 Feb 1762

Birth Location: Albemarle, Virginia, United States

Death Date: 12 Mar 1835

Death Location: Patrick, Virginia, United States

Father: Francis Turner

Mother: Elizabeth Gilley

Spouse(s): Mary Pilson

Children(s): (Rev.) Turner

In 1762, Adam Turner entered the world in Albemarle, Virginia, United States, born to Francis Turner And Elizabeth Gilley. Adam Turner married Mary Polly Nancy Pilson, and had children including Rev John Morgan Turner. Adam Turner passed away in 1835 in Patrick, Virginia, United States.
